ABSTRACT: The uploaded data are described within "Screen Identifies DYRK1B Network as Mediator of Transcription Repression on Damaged Chromatin". In short, peptides from RPE1 epithelial cells with either normal expression of DYRK1B, over expression, of knockout of the kinase were TMT11 plex labeled and enriched by tandem phosphopeptide enrichment.
